About Life Insurance Law in Lubumbashi, DR Congo

Life insurance in Lubumbashi, DR Congo is regulated by local laws that govern the purchase, terms, and conditions of life insurance policies. These laws aim to protect policyholders and ensure fair practices within the insurance industry.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

Legal assistance may be needed in various situations related to life insurance, such as disputes over policy terms, claims denial, beneficiaries' rights, or issues with insurance companies. A lawyer can provide guidance, representation, and help navigate the complexities of life insurance law.

Local Laws Overview

The key aspects of local laws related to life insurance in Lubumbashi, DR Congo include the regulation of insurance companies, policy terms, claims procedures, and the rights of policyholders and beneficiaries. It is important to understand these laws to ensure compliance and protection under a life insurance policy.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What is life insurance?

Life insurance is a contract between an individual and an insurance company where the insured pays premiums in exchange for a sum of money to be paid to beneficiaries upon the insured's death.

2. How do I choose the right life insurance policy?

Choosing the right life insurance policy depends on your financial goals, needs, and budget. Consider factors such as coverage amount, type of policy, and premium costs when selecting a policy.

3. Can I dispute a denied life insurance claim?

Yes, you have the right to dispute a denied life insurance claim. A lawyer can help you appeal the decision and navigate the claims process to ensure you receive the benefits you are entitled to.

4. What happens if the insurance company goes bankrupt?

If an insurance company goes bankrupt, there are protections in place to ensure policyholders still receive their benefits. The regulatory body overseeing insurance in DR Congo will intervene to protect policyholders' rights.

5. Can I change beneficiaries on my life insurance policy?

Yes, you can typically change beneficiaries on your life insurance policy at any time by submitting a written request to your insurance company. It is important to keep your beneficiary designations up to date.

6. Do I need a lawyer to review my life insurance policy?

While not required, having a lawyer review your life insurance policy can provide you with valuable insights into the terms, conditions, and potential pitfalls of the policy. A lawyer can ensure that the policy meets your needs and protects your interests.

7. What should I do if I suspect life insurance fraud?

If you suspect life insurance fraud, you should report it to the appropriate authorities or contact a lawyer for guidance on how to proceed. Fraudulent activities in the insurance industry can have serious consequences and should be addressed promptly.

8. Are there any tax implications of life insurance in DR Congo?

Life insurance benefits are typically tax-free in DR Congo. However, it is advisable to consult with a tax professional or lawyer to understand any specific tax implications related to your life insurance policy.

9. Can I cancel my life insurance policy?

Yes, you can cancel your life insurance policy at any time by contacting your insurance company and following their cancellation procedures. Keep in mind that cancelling a policy may have financial implications, so it is advisable to consult with a lawyer before making a decision.

10. How can a lawyer help me with a life insurance claim dispute?

A lawyer can help you gather evidence, negotiate with the insurance company, and represent your interests in a life insurance claim dispute. They can also guide you through the legal process and help you understand your rights and options.
